Ruff Figural Fluency Test

Ronald M. Ruff, PhD

Purpose:
Provides information about nonverbal capacity for initiation, planning, and divergent reasoning
Format:
Paper and pencil
Age range:
16 years to 70 years
Time:
5 minutes (60 seconds for each of the 5 parts)

The RFFT was developed to provide clinical information regarding nonverbal capacity for fluid and divergent thinking, ability to shift cognitive set, planning strategies, and executive ability to coordinate this process.

Features and benefits

  • The test booklet consists of five 60-second parts, each with a different stimulus presentation.
  • The respondent draws as many unique designs as possible within 60 seconds by connecting the dots in different patterns. The total number of unique designs drawn constitutes the main score.
  • The Perseverative Errors score represents the number of repetitions of the same pattern drawn by the respondent.
  • The Error Ratio index assesses the respondent’s ability to minimize repetition while maximizing unique productions.
  • Qualitative strategies, such as rotation and enumeration, can also be assessed.

Note: Stopwatch is required for administration.
